NSS
National Service Scheme popularly known as NSS, the scheme was launched in Mahatma Gandhi Centenary year 1969 and aimed at developing students’ personalities through community service. The overall objective of the National Service is education. This objective is attained through the service to the community. National Service Scheme (NSS) is a permanent youth Program under the Ministry of Youth Affairs and Sports, Government of India, and funded by the Government of Chhattisgarh and the Government of India.
The overall objective of NSS is Personality Development through community service. The objectives of NSS are to:
- Understand the community in which they work
- Understand themselves in relation to their community
- Identify the needs and problems of the community and involve them in the problem-solving process.
- Develop among themselves a sense of social and civic responsibility
- Utilize their knowledge in finding practical solutions to individual and community problems
- Develop competence required for group-living and sharing of responsibilities
- Gain skills in mobilizing community participation
- Acquire leadership qualities and a democratic attitude
- Develop capacity to meet emergencies and natural disasters and
- Practice national integration and social harmony
